Joshua 22:6

So Joshua blessed them and sent them away, and they went to their tents.

Joshua 14:13

So Joshua blessed him and gave Hebron to Caleb the son of Jephunneh as an inheritance.

Genesis 47:7

Then Joseph brought Jacob (Israel) his father and presented him before Pharaoh; and Jacob blessed Pharaoh.

Exodus 39:43

And Moses [carefully] inspected all the work, and behold, they had done it; just as the Lord had commanded, so had they done it. So Moses blessed them.

2 Samuel 6:18

When David had finished offering the burnt offerings and peace offerings, he blessed the people in the name of the Lord of hosts (armies),

Luke 24:50

Then He led them out as far as Bethany, and lifted up His hands and blessed them.

Genesis 14:19

And Melchizedek blessed Abram and said,

“Blessed (joyful, favored) be Abram by God Most High,
Creator and Possessor of heaven and earth;

Genesis 47:10

And Jacob blessed Pharaoh, and departed from his presence.

Joshua 22:7-8

Now to the one-half of the tribe of Manasseh Moses had given a possession in Bashan, but to the other half Joshua gave a possession on the west side of the Jordan among their brothers. So when Joshua sent them away to their tents, he blessed them,

1 Samuel 2:20

Then Eli would bless Elkanah and his wife and say, “May the Lord give you children by this woman in place of the one she asked for which was dedicated to the Lord.” Then they would return to their own home.

2 Samuel 6:20

Then David returned to bless his household. But [his wife] Michal the daughter of Saul came out to meet David and said, “How glorious and distinguished was the king of Israel today, who uncovered himself and stripped [off his kingly robes] in the eyes of his servants’ maids like one of the riffraff who shamelessly uncovers himself!”

2 Chronicles 30:18

For the majority of the people, many from Ephraim and Manasseh, Issachar and Zebulun, had not purified themselves, and yet they ate the Passover contrary to what had been prescribed. For Hezekiah had prayed for them, saying, “May the good Lord pardon

Luke 2:34

Simeon blessed them and said to Mary His mother, “Listen carefully: this Child is appointed and destined for the fall and rise of many in Israel, and for a sign that is to be opposed—

Hebrews 7:6-7

But this person [Melchizedek] who is not from their Levitical ancestry received tithes from Abraham and blessed him who possessed the promises [of God].
